Marhapatra Population, Caste, Working Data Sambalpur, Odisha - Census 2011

Marhapatra is a village situated in Katarbaga block of Sambalpur district in Odisha. As per the Population Census 2011, there are a total of 83 families residing in the village Marhapatra. The total population of Marhapatra is 292 out of which 143 are males and 149 are females thus the Average Sex Ratio of Marhapatra is 1,042.

The population of Children aged 0-6 years in Marhapatra village is 36 which is 12% of the total population. There are 15 male children and 21 female children between the age 0-6 years. Thus as per the Census 2011 the Child Sex Ratio of Marhapatra is 1,400 which is greater than Average Sex Ratio (1,042) of Marhapatra village.

As per the Census 2011, the literacy rate of Marhapatra is 70.7%. Thus Marhapatra village has a higher literacy rate compared to 67.6% of Sambalpur district. The male literacy rate is 85.16% and the female literacy rate is 56.25% in Marhapatra village.

Caste Data as per Census 2011

Schedule Caste (SC) constitutes 18.5% while Schedule Tribe (ST) were 55.8% of total population in Marhapatra village.


Working Population as per Census 2011

In Marhapatra village out of total population, 176 were engaged in work activities. 93.2% of workers describe their work as Main Work (Employment or Earning more than 6 Months) while 6.8% were involved in Marginal activity providing livelihood for less than 6 months. Of 176 workers engaged in Main Work, 32 were cultivators (owner or co-owner) while 122 were Agricultural labourers.
